[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read Christian Knoke
Follow-up Comment #5, bug #21703 (project freeciv): Cannot reproduce in Version 2.4.2+ (r24530). Even if I change it back to Library, I won't get 22 stones back. Think this 2nd bug. Seen this too, But don't know where. Christian ___

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read Christian Knoke
Follow-up Comment #6, bug #21703 (project freeciv): Can reproduce in Freeciv Version 2.4.2+ (r24482) on ARM. (Server) Client on i386. Options to autogen.sh were (most probably): --enable-svnrev --enable-client=gtk2 --enable-fcmp=yes --with-readline --with-efence --enable-fcdb=all

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read Jacob Nevins
Follow-up Comment #7, bug #21703 (project freeciv): OP: I've attached a saved file. Playing Saxionians. In 4 Cities I currently building a Library. If I change production in anyone of those cities into Temple, I am losing stones. I still can't reproduce from this savegame with 2.4.2 (server

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read Christian Knoke
Follow-up Comment #8, bug #21703 (project freeciv): Even if I change it back to Library, I won't get 22 stones back. I'm wondering if loading the changed_from target from a savefile (or maybe sending it over the network?) is going wrong, possibly in a platform-dependent way. I think this

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read Christian Knoke
Follow-up Comment #9, bug #21703 (project freeciv): chris@sheva:~/freeciv/play$ gdb freeciv-server GNU gdb (GDB) 7.4.1-debian Copyright (C) 2012 Free Software Foundation, Inc. This GDB was configured as arm-linux-gnueabi. Reading symbols from /usr/local/bin/freeciv-server...done. (gdb) run

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read Christian Knoke
Follow-up Comment #10, bug #21703 (project freeciv): neon is for floating point Starting program: /usr/local/bin/freeciv-server [Thread debugging using libthread_db enabled] Using host libthread_db library /lib/arm-linux-gnueabi/libthread_db.so.1. Program received signal SIGILL, Illegal

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read Jacob Nevins
Follow-up Comment #11, bug #21703 (project freeciv): My random guess is it'll not turn out to be an FPU issue (I don't think there's any floating point arithmetic nearby), but us naughtily trying to stuff an int in an enum-shaped hole, or something like that.

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-23 Thread anonymous
Follow-up Comment #12, bug #21703 (project freeciv): Got additional information for it. The penalty is only applied after finishing a wonder in the city. Whenever I change the production for the first post-wonder city improvement to some other improvement, the penalty is applied. Like finishing

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-22 Thread Jacob Nevins
Follow-up Comment #1, bug #21703 (project freeciv): Can't reproduce with 2.4.2. Which specific two buildings are you changing between? (Note that small wonders such as the Palace count as wonders for the purposes of this penalty.) ___

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-22 Thread anonymous
Follow-up Comment #2, bug #21703 (project freeciv): In the last weeks I have played all branches, and have noticed some kind of penalty when changing between _city improvements_ (not wonders or untis) - but rare, not in all cases, irregurarly it seemed. But I wasn't focused on that. Before

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-22 Thread anonymous
Follow-up Comment #3, bug #21703 (project freeciv): Running the self compiled server on raspberry pi. The client is Gtk2, installed on windows. The production change was from Library to Temple (stones going down from 22 to 11). Even if I change it back to Library, I won't get 22 stones back.

[Freeciv-Dev] [bug #21703] penalty applied when change between city improvements

2014-02-21 Thread anonymous
URL: http://gna.org/bugs/?21703 Summary: penalty applied when change between city improvements Project: Freeciv Submitted by: None Submitted on: Fri 21 Feb 2014 04:57:18 PM UTC Category: general Severity: